## Releases

Tilecrate publishes signed release tarballs for its rendering-cache layer on a monthly cadence. Security reviewers should verify that each artifact's detached signature matches the manifest before approving deployment, and that cache-eviction binaries were built in the reproducible pipeline. All signatures chain to a single offline root. The active release signing key appears below.

deploy key for kajof-fajop: bky6_gDHw9Q

**Q: Can I pause Nightloom backfills during a release window?**

Yep — just flip the freeze toggle before the 01:00 kickoff and the scheduler skips that night's run cleanly. Don't kill jobs mid-flight; they'll leave partial partitions. The freeze toggle and the rerun procedure are documented on this page.

operations page: https://jira.lumiclabs.internal/pages/display/projects/af69ce92

Runbook — Checkrail validator plugin system. Each validator plugin loads from the registry at boot; failed signature checks drop the plugin and log to the Fennwick audit stream. To add a plugin: publish to the registry, bump PLUGIN_MANIFEST_REV, restart the loader. Never hot-swap validators mid-batch — partial runs corrupt the report index. The loader authenticates to the registry with a pull token, rotated by platform every 60 days. Set the pull token in .env on the next line.

sealed setting: ARCHIVE_KEY3=8d0